Types of Cat Doors:
Standard Flap Doors: These are basic, affordable doors with a versatile flap that the cat pushes through.Magnetic Cat Doors: These doors need the [weatherproof cat flap installation](https://www.footballzaa.com/out.php?url=https://www.repairmywindowsanddoors.co.uk/stretford-cat-flap-installer-near-me/) to wear a magnetic collar, preventing unwanted animals from going into.Microchip Cat Doors: These are the most secure and sophisticated options, reading your cat's microchip to enable entry only to your pet, staying out roaming animals and preserving home security.Tunnel Cat Doors: Designed for thicker walls or doors, these doors use a tunnel extension to bridge the gap.

Cost Considerations for Professional Installation:

The cost of professional cat door installation can differ depending upon numerous aspects:
Type of Cat Door: More sophisticated doors like microchip models might have a somewhat greater installation cost due to their complexity.Installation Location and Material: Installing in glass or walls is generally more complex and might cost more than installing in a basic wood door.Complexity of the Job: If modifications to the door frame or surrounding structure are required, this can increase the general cost.Installer's Rates and Location: Installer rates can vary depending on their experience, place, and local market value.
It's constantly best to get an in-depth quote from the installer before continuing, outlining all costs included.
